Many people confuse your skin complexion with your skin undertone, but they are entirely different things.
Your skin's surface tone is the color that you can see on the surface of your skin, often described as light, medium, tan, deep, and so on. Your skin undertone is the color underneath the surface of your skin.
You may have the same complexion as someone, but that does not necessarily mean you have the same undertone. Your skin's surface color can change, due to factors like sun exposure, which is why some of us are lighter during the fall and winter months and get darker during spring and summer.
Your skin's undertone remains the same, although it can look like it has changed.

For this test what you want to do is stand in a place with natural light, preferably a window when it is sunny out, and use a mirror to look at your under eyes.
If the skin under your eyes a bit purple or blue you are a cool tone. However, if the skin under your eyes appears to be more of a yellowish color you are a warm tone. Not everyone has these colors underneath their eyes to help determine their skin tone but do not worry there are several more tests!
Hold a white piece of paper up to your face. Looking in a mirror, try to see how your skin looks in contrast to the white paper. Your skin tone is warm if your skin appears yellowish or sallow beside the white paper. If your skin seems pink, rosy, or blueish-red, then you have a cool skin tone.
When having a neutral skin tone, you can't determine any cast of yellow, olive, or pink.
If your skin burns quickly in the sun, you are most likely a cool tone. And if your skin tans easily you are a warm tone.
If you have spent more than an hour in the sun you probably already know this answer, and it is not necessary to go out and complete this test! This test is not easy to determine if you are neutral as your skin can react either way.
You want to flip your wrist and look at your veins for this analysis.
You are a cool tone if your veins appear bluish or purplish. If your veins appear green, you are a warm tone.
You're most likely neutral if you have both!

Alopecia Areata is an autoimmune disease.
It is a type of hair loss that occurs when your immune system mistakenly attacks hair follicles, which is where hair growth begins. This form of Alopecia affects both women and men. Alopecia Areata is an alopecia type that can happen over time with gradual thinning of hair or fall out quickly in large clumps.
Alopecia Areata is incurable but treatable. Most people grow their hair back although some people experience hair loss in other areas of their heads later on. Alopecia Totalis is an alopecia type that spreads across the entire scalp. Heredity causes Androgenetic Alopecia.
Alopecia Universalis occurs over the whole body taking out one's eyelashes, eyebrows, and any natural hair.
Traction is a form of alopecia, or hair loss, caused mainly by pulling force applied to the hair.
It is usually created as a result of the sufferer frequently wearing their hair in a particularly tight ponytail, pigtails, or braids. Traction Alopecia is the only form of Alopecia that is not genetic and happens due to outside factors.
Signs of traction alopecia include bumpy rashes, scalp redness, itching, and scaling. There are early signs of traction alopecia occurring due to irritation of the scalp and damaged or broken hair follicles. In more extreme cases one might have pus-filled blisters on the scalp and inflammation of the scalp.

The L.O.C method is a personal favorite.
The initials stand for Liquid Oil Cream. When my hair is unusually dry, I use the L.O.C Method to ensure moisture retention.
The L.O.C method is good for in-between wash days and requires a layering of products. First, you should apply a water-based liquid to the hair, then seal the moisture with oil, and finally administer a cream or butter to style.
However, there are times when we expose our hair to too much of a good thing. When your hair starts to feel limp and too moist, almost to the point where it is mushy, your long locks may be missing protein.
A lack of protein can also cause breakage and result in ends that look see-through.
To maintain consistency throughout the density of your hair make sure that you do not over moisturize and treat your hair to a protein treatment every now and again to strengthen the hair shaft.

Now onto the science portion of today’s lesson.
The typical shampoo is basic, which means the pH level is high.
Your hair is acidic which is the opposite of basic, and the two do not like to co-mingle as much as you would think. That is why you hear so much about shampoos stripping your hair of its natural oils.
And even worse, is over washed hair that can result in the hair shaft being compromised and wearing away.
Your hair and skin react well to a solution with a pH of about 5.5.
A good astringent to use to clean your scalp and hair would be diluted apple cider vinegar. To do that you should fill an empty spray bottle with two parts water and part ACV.
This solution will give you the perfect amount of ACV to cleanse your scalp on wash day.

]]>Dropshipping hair extensions is a technique of business where the product is shipped to the consumer directly from a wholesale warehouse, thus eliminating the need for a company to hold a large amount of stock.
Orders are placed with the retailer, who then, in turn, sends the customer's shipping information to the wholesaler for shipment.
From here the wholesaler ships the item to the customer, often using custom hair extension packaging, such as return labels and packing slips with the retailer's logo. The process helps to cut out the middleman while saving space for the retailer.

The hair weave business has changed dramatically over the past decade.
Today, there are so many different types of hair extensions and marketing terms to quantify the quality of hair.
"Chinese manufacturers and Chinese trading companies created the (5A, 6A, 7A, 8A, 9A, 10A) grading system as an easy way to explain to their clients "how good the hair is."
Although, there is a catch.
Do you remember just five years ago when "5A" hair was so amazing? That might have been back around 2012 - 2013.
But wait! Then there was "6A" hair in 2014. Of course, that was then the best hair extensions.
In 2015 we were introduced to "7A" Brazilian hair weave was then considered the new top grade.
The amazing "8A" virgin hair was then popular in 2016, and now in 2017, the "9A" hair weave is the best.
In 2018, you would see trading companies trying to say their "10A" hair was the best.
Remember when "11A" hair weave was the new high-grade hair extension and the talk of the town in 2019?
In 2021, we are looking at all sorts of numbers and I don't know if it will ever stop.
Anyone want to make a prediction of what the "Top Grade of Hair" will be in 2030? Probably 20A Grade Hair? Remember, it's all fictitious anyways!
Do you see the trend here? Every year Chinese hair manufacturers add an additional "A" to their hair to stay competitive. In reality, it is all just hair extension marketing.
Currently, there is not a "Universal Standard" for human hair extension grading. Therefore, there is not a standard hair grade chart that you can pull up, and it is accurate.
Technically someone could call their hair extensions 8A despite being smelly, crappy, tangling, non-Remy hair.

A hair transplant is a surgical procedure that moves hair from one part of the body (the donor site) to a bald or balding part of the body (the recipient site). It's primarily used to treat male pattern baldness.
The procedure can take anywhere from 4 to 8 hours, depending on the extent of the transplant.
Patients are given local anesthesia during the procedure, so you shouldn't feel pain. There may be some discomfort and slight pain during recovery, which can be managed with pain relievers.
Like any surgical procedure, risks include infection, bleeding, scarring, and unnatural-looking new hair growth. However, complications are rare when the procedure is done by an experienced surgeon.
Recovery varies by individual, but most people can return to work within a few days. It’s common to see some swelling and scarring that fades over time.
It typically takes between 6 to 12 months to see the full results of the transplant. Initially, the transplanted hair will fall out before new growth begins.
The cost varies widely depending on the extent of the transplant and the technique used, ranging from $4,000 to $15,000 or more. It's rarely covered by insurance.
Yes, transplanted hair is generally permanent. However, hair loss might continue in other areas, requiring further treatment or transplants.
FUE (Follicular Unit Extraction) involves extracting individual hair follicles and transplanting them, while FUT (Follicular Unit Transplantation) involves removing a strip of skin with hair follicles and then transplanting the follicles. FUE leaves less noticeable scars and has a shorter recovery time.
Not everyone is a good candidate. Ideal candidates have sufficient hair density at the donor site and healthy scalp conditions. A consultation with a hair transplant specialist is necessary to evaluate eligibility.

Semi-permanent colors or rinses are typically non-damaging to the hair and can aid in the health of your hair.
They provide a protective, non-permanent coating to the hair, adding shine and sealing down the cuticle. The result is a fresh color that feels soft and silky. Check out this list of my favorite semi-permanent color lines:
Clairol Professional Beautiful Collection is a moisturizing color line that is gentle enough to use directly after a relaxer. Leaves hair feeling moisturized with Aloe Vera, Jojoba Oil, and Vitamin E.
This color line is available in 56 shades with no ammonia, peroxide, or alcohol. Adore's formula offers a perfect blend of natural ingredients providing rich color, enhancing shine, and leaving hair soft and silky.
Joico Vero K-PAK Color Intensity Color System gives hair color pros the power to create vivid, on-trend, insanely intense shades.
With these color lines, you cannot go wrong. Keep in mind that these semi-permanent haircolors will create a natural gloss and enrich the natural color of your hair.
If you choose to use a fashion color like blue, red, etc., you will notice a slight hue of color when in the sun. If you want to see vivid, vibrant results when working with pastel colors, it is best to apply semi-permanent hair color on pre-lightened hair. These colors will not lighten your hair! As I stated earlier in this article, semi-permanent color is a non-damaging color that coats the cuticle, never penetrating into the cortex. The semi-permanent color will never lift the natural or previous color of your hair, and it may only last about two to four weeks, depending on how often you shampoo your hair. After many applications and over time, the color will start to last longer due to so many coats compared to one use.

The sewing method offers a more secure style. Keeping the extensions in place until you’re ready to take them out.
To prepare for this style, you will need a needle and thread, and your hair will need to be braided.
The two most common braid patterns for the sewing method are a circular style, the beehive, or straight back.
The desired braiding pattern often depends on how you want the extensions to lay or where your part will be located. You should consult with whoever is sewing your hair so they can best advise you.
Once you’re all braided up, you will need the needle and thread. I prefer using nylon thread because it yields a more durable sewin. Place thread through the needle and tie a knot to secure the thread in place first. Then, starting at either side of the nape of the hair, begin sewing the needle with the wefts through the braid, pull the thread all the way out, and repeat.
In this method, the thread locks the tracks to the braid, so it’s super secure. Also, the takedown for this method is really easy too! All you do is simply cut the thread out! Just be careful not to cut your own hair, though! It’s always best to have someone do it for you.

Mirco-links are also making its stamp in the beauty industry. It is a tedious installation method that may take up to three to four hours to complete; and requires a specially trained hairstylist to install.
You must have a clamping tool, also known as hair pliers, to install the extensions for micro-linking. Micro-links are attached with a bead that gets applied to each of your hair strands. Your natural hair goes through the bead that is applied on a loop, and then the extensions go through next. When the hair goes through the bead, clamp it in to secure the section.
Once installed, you can treat it like your own hair. You will be able to wash, cut, style, and color the hair, of course, assuming the hair is 100% virgin.
You’re guaranteed to have long-lasting wear with this hair! This method will ensure a seamless, natural look that will leave spectators wondering if it’s all your hair!

Another way to customize your HD lace wig is to bleach the knots.
Bleaching the knots involves lightening the base of the hair tied to the lace, creating a more natural-looking appearance. You will need a bleaching powder and a developer to bleach the knots.
Private Label Partner and celebrity hairstylist Dallas Christopher recommends using Cream Developer 10-20 volume with Paul Mitchell Dual Purpose Lightener formula.
This lightener lifts hair evenly and quickly with control. It has natural oils and conditioning agents such as jojoba oils and castor beans to help buffer the lightning process and reduce the knots' damage.
Mix the powder and developer according to the package instructions, and apply the mixture to the knots on the wig. Follow the manufacturer's recommendations for leaving the mix on the knots.
(The viscosity of the mixture should be like whip cream, a thick consistency so that the product does not crawl further up the hair shaft of your wig during process time.)
Once the desired lightness is achieved, rinse the wig thoroughly and allow it to dry. Bleaching the knots can be a time-consuming and potentially damaging process, so it's essential to be careful and follow the instructions carefully. Dallas, Fill in anything you like here.
(Depending on the shade of lightness achieved with your lightning process, use a blue shampoo or violet shampoo to help tone out unwanted orange or yellow undertones.)
